最近在搭建自己的網站時,遇到了一個問題:服務器無法解析CSS文件。這導致網站的樣式無法正常顯示,頁面變得非常丑陋。
經過排查和調試,我發現了問題的根源:我在CSS文件中使用了相對路徑引用了其他文件。這在本地調試時沒有問題,但在服務器上就出現了無法解析的情況。
為解決這個問題,我嘗試了幾種方法:
1. 使用絕對路徑引用文件 這樣可以確保服務器能夠找到文件,但是如果文件路徑修改了,需要手動修改CSS文件中的引用路徑,比較麻煩。
2. 使用相對路徑引用文件 如果文件路徑不變,這種方法是可行的。但是在服務器上時,需要注意引用路徑的正確性。
3. 將CSS文件和其他文件都放到同一個目錄中 這種方法可以避免相對路徑引用文件時產生的問題,但是文件目錄可能變得雜亂無章。
最終我選擇了第一種方法,因為我的文件路徑不會經常發生變化。如果您遇到了類似的問題,可以根據自己的情況選擇相應的方法來解決。希望這篇文章對你有所幫助。
上一篇服務器打不開css
下一篇css超過長度顯示出來